Abstract

381,232. Two - way transmission. ELECTRICAL RESEARCH PRODUCTS, Inc., 195, Broadway, New York, U.S.A.- (Assignees of Bjornson, B. G. ; 57, Horatio Street, New York, U.S.A.) July 3,1931, No. 19268. Convention date, July 9, 1930. [Class 40 (iv).] In a two-way submarine cable system in which a speaker in one direction gets complete control of the system so that speech in the other direction can only normally take place after a pause in the first speech equal to at least the transmission time over the cable (T), the control circuits are so modified after a predetermined time that the distant listener is able to break in and obtain complete control during a slight pause which may only be that normally occurring between words. In the system shown, when speech arrives over land line TL, relays 7, 8 transmit a courier control pulse over the cable TC, network 1 delaying the speech for a short time (t) sufficient for the control operations to be completed. At the distant station the courier pulse passing through filter 23 operates relays 27, 28, 29 for conditioning the transmitting and receiving branches, relay 30 for disconnecting relay 16, and relay 26 for connecting up speech filter 24 whereby the speech takes over the control initiated by the courier. At about the same instant at the transmitting station, part of the courier pulse which has been delayed for time T-t in network 14 passes into circuit 13 operating relay 16 to prevent any change of condition by received speech. After a further period T produced by network 18 control device 19 operates energizing relay 20 which disconnects circuit 13 so that the control of relay 16 now takes place over its left-hand winding by speech passing through delay circuits 14, 18. At a slight pause in the received speech, during the period between the release of relays 30, 31, the distant listener can break in, operating relay 16 immediately over its right-hand winding and sending a courier pulse back to the transmitting end at which the arrival of the courier will synchronize with the release of relay 16 so that both stations are now conditioned for speech in the opposite direction. Specification 338,971, [Class 40 (iv), Telephones &c.], is referred to.
